WebMake a “nest” that fits the bird. On top of the cloth or paper towels in the bottom of the box, roll a second small towel (this needs to be a cloth one, but not terry cloth) into a doughnut shape. Place the bird lying down (if he will lie down) inside the “nest.”. If he doesn’t stay there, that’s OK. Web23 Jan 2024 · Second Chance Bird Rescue in Bend seeks volunteers. Watch on.
